The Basics of Weather Models,

Abstract

Without using mathematics, this memo summarizes the important information weather forecasters need to know to apply numerical weather prediction (NWP) forecasts. We've had to make some tough choices regarding what material to include. We've put the more technically rigorous information in an appendix; readers can review this material as they have time. We've organized the material under three main topics: History of NWP; Components of an NWP model; Strengths and weaknesses of NWP models--what these models can and cannot do.
